Report Date: July 01, 2020

COVID-19 Morbidity and Mortality by Geography

GEOGRAPHY CASES1 DEATHS
Chicago 52,569 2,611
Suburban Cook County (IDPH) 38,351 1,970
Illinois (IDPH) 144,013 6,951
U.S. (CDC) 2,624,873 127,299
World (WHO) 10,357,662 508,055
1Does not include persons with pending COVID-19 tests or persons with COVID-19 related illness who have not been tested.

 

COVID-19 Death Characteristics for Chicago residents

CHARACTERISTIC  DEATHS % TOTAL DEATHS % DEATHS WITHIN GROUP RATE PER 100,000 POPULATION
Chicago 2,611 100% 5.0% 96.2
Age
0-17 2 0.1% 0.1% 0.4
18-29 18 0.7% 0.2% 3.3
30-39 65 2.5% 0.7% 14.2
40-49 140 5.4% 1.5% 41.6
50-59 289 11.1% 3.2% 92.3
60-69 568 21.8% 9.0% 216.0
70+ 1,529 58.5% 24.8% 649.8
Gender 
Female 1,067 40.9% 4.1% 77.0
Male 1,544 59.1% 6.1% 117.0
Under investigation 0 0.0% 0.1% -
Race-ethnicity2
Latinx 832 32.8% 4.2% 107.1
Black, non-Latinx 1,132 43.5% 9.2% 144.3
White, non-Latinx 497 19.1% 8.2% 55.2
Asian, non-Latinx 120 4.6% 10.5% 66.7
Other, non-Latinx 21 0.9% 1.0% 18.4
Under investigation 9 0.3% 0.1% -
2Race-ethnicity percentage is calculated among those with known race-ethnicity as reported by the medical provider.
 

COVID-19 Case Characteristics for Chicago residents 

CHARACTERISTIC  NUMBER % TOTAL CASES1 RATE PER 100,000
Chicago 52,569 100% 1,942.7
Age
0-17 2,544 4.8% 463.4
18-29 9,785 18.6% 1,769.6
30-39 9,323 17.7% 2,043.1
40-49 9,479 18.90 2,817.3
50-59 8,911 17.0% 2,847.3
60-69 6,340 12.1% 2,410.7
70+ 6,176 11.7% 2,624.5
Under investigation 11 0.0% -
Gender 
Female 26,081 49.6% 1,881.6
Male 25,505 48.5% 1,932.4
Under investigation 983 1.9% -
Race-ethnicity2
Latinx 19,790 47.7% 2,548.1
Black, non-Latinx 12,308 29.67 1,569.4
White, non-Latinx 6,025 14.5% 669.5
Asian, non-Latinx 1,142 2.8% 635.0
Other, non-Latinx 2,201 5.3% 1,842.3
Under investigation 11,103 21.1% -
2Race-ethnicity percentage is calculated among those with known race-ethnicity as reported by the medical provider.
